Expansion of DSW Tax Advisory capabilities

 

DSW Capital, a profitable, mid-market, challenger professional services licence network and owner of the Dow Schofield Watts brand, is pleased to announce that it has supported DSW Tax Advisory's acquisition of STS Europe Ltd ("STS") to bring new, complementary capabilities to the business.

 

STS advises clients, including UK-resident non-domiciles, on matters such as inheritance tax, trusts and offshore structures, and also assists offshore banks and trust companies throughout Europe with UK tax issues and is one of the leading firms of its type in the North.

 

STS will be integrated under the DSW Tax Advisory brand, taking its Fee Earners to three.

 

The acquisition of STS takes DSW's total Fee Earners to 105, operating from 10 locations across the UK.

 

James Dow, Chief Executive Officer, said:

 

"I am delighted to welcome Andrew Robinson to DSW. Tax advisory is a target area of expansion for the Group, enabling enhanced cross referral, particularly for Corporate Finance and Wealth Advisory where tax advisory is highly relevant. Referrals are a key element behind of the success of our network and help to drive the organic growth of the Group. Referrals in FY23 comprised 14.2% of Network Revenue and we expect this to grow as we focus on strengthening the depth and breadth of our services."

 

Dave Waddington of DSW Tax Advisory said:

 

"STS has built a strong reputation for its work with high-net worth clients and offshore trusts. The acquisition brings new expertise to DSW Tax Advisory and enables us to expand the range of services we offer our clients."

About DSW Capital

 

DSW Capital, owner of the Dow Schofield Watts brand, is a profitable, mid-market, challenger professional services network with a cash generative business model and scalable platform for growth. Originally established in 2002, by three KPMG alumni, DSW is one of the first platform models disrupting the traditional model of accounting professional services firms. DSW operates licensing arrangements with 24 licensee businesses with 105 fee earners, across ten offices in England and two in Scotland. These trade primarily under the Dow Schofield Watts brand. It also operates Pandea Global M&A, an international corporate finance network covering 33 different countries.

 

DSW's vision is for the DSW Network to become the most sought-after destination for ambitious, entrepreneurial professionals to start and develop their own businesses. Through a licensing model, DSW gives professionals the autonomy and flexibility to fulfil their potential. Being part of the DSW Network brings support benefits in recruitment, funding and infrastructure. DSW's challenger model attracts experienced, senior professionals, predominantly with a "Big 4" accounting firm background, who want to launch their own businesses and recognise the value of the Dow Schofield Watts brand and the synergies which come from being part of the DSW Network.
